Interviewing for Work

July 25, 2023 @ 12:00 pm - 1:30 pm

Program Details
Date: Tuesday July 25, 2023
Time: 12:00 – 1:30 pm
Location: GB202

In this session, you will receive a brief review of interviewing strategies, including practice giving and receiving feedback on your interview techniques. Specifically, you will: 

  • Describe strategies for effectively preparing for interviews and techniques for responding to different types of interview questions. 
  • Practice responding to interview questions and giving feedback to interview responses. 
  • Discover resources and services to support you during the interview process. 

It is highly recommended that you review the 15-minute Interview Preparation Module Course before attending.  

 Facilitator: Joanne Lieu, Graduate Professional Development Coordinator, Office of the Vice Dean, Graduate Studies
